Technical Details
ShipAhead is built on a modern web stack, primarily utilizing Nuxt and Vue.js for the frontend, styled with TailwindCSS and daisyUI. The backend leverages Drizzle ORM with PostgreSQL for data management, Cloudflare R2 or AWS S3 for file storage, and Redis for rate limiting. It integrates with Stripe for payments, Cloudflare Turnstile for security, and supports deployment on platforms like Vercel and Cloudflare.
